No Borders-No Country

It really is a pretty simple concept to understand. Without viable, recognizable and protected borders, a country will not and cannot maintain its sovereignty or its very “being” as a country. Said country will not survive. But, that is what the majority of US Senators, both Democrat and Republican, are now pushing.

Both US political party Senators are laying down the law to the American people—the ones who are legal citizens. Their message is: “You will accept illegals!” The McCain-Kennedy bill provides a “path toward citizenship” for those already in the US illegally. We are told “it’s not amnesty”. But, it is. “Republican” Senator Arlen Specter tells us repeatedly that this proposal and the changes the Senate is making to water-down the approved US House of Representatives’ immigration bill (the one with real “teeth”) will not include amnesty for illegals. But, it does. Specter is also against the US building any sort of obstacle (AKA “fence”) at our Southern border, to prevent illegals (which also include terrorists) from entering. A Quinnipiac poll shows that 57% of US citizens surveyed believe that the illegal immigrant situation is a serious problem. Other polls show this figure to be substantially higher. Director of the Quinnipiac University Polling Institute Maurice Carroll commented: “People think this is a horrible problem, and they are not being very friendly to illegal immigrants.”
